网站开发综合实训实训指导书

网站开发综合实训实训指导书

ID:39397292

大小:1.45 MB

页数:17页

时间:2019-07-02

上传者:无敌小子
网站开发综合实训实训指导书_第1页
网站开发综合实训实训指导书_第2页
网站开发综合实训实训指导书_第3页
网站开发综合实训实训指导书_第4页
网站开发综合实训实训指导书_第5页
资源描述:

《网站开发综合实训实训指导书》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

网站开发综合实训实训指导书电子商务专业适用孙铀编写大连职业技术学院信息技术系电子商务教研室16 目录实训一利用ASP技术实现网络简易投票系统2实训二筛选排序例916 实验(训)一利用ASP技术实现网络简易投票系统一、利用网页制作软件DreamWeaver或FrontPage制作投票系统的静态页面(标题前不空格,标题后换行)(小四号,加粗)(一)插入表单容器并设置提示文本,表单样式1.单击“插入面板”中的“表单”标签如上图2.插入提示文本(可以在红色虚线框内插入)如上图3.设置单选按钮的外框架样式,插入4*2的“0”边框表格(1)单击“插入面板”中的“常用”标签(2)确认光标在“?”后面,单击“表格”标签(3)按下图进行设置16 4.合并最后一行的两个单元格,如下图(二)插入提示文本和表单元素(提交按钮)并设置其属性1.插入提示文本,如下图所示16 1.单击“插入面板”中的“表单”标签,点击“单选按钮”在对应位置插入3个单选按钮,如下图2.设置这三个单选按钮的属性(1)点击第一个单选按钮,设置组名称为“ball”,值为“0”(为数组元素下标)(2)点击第二个单选按钮,设置组名称为“ball”,值为“1”(为数组元素下标)(3)点击第三个单选按钮,设置组名称为“ball”,值为“2”(为数组元素下标)16 (三)设置表单属性1.点击“

”标签2.设置“方法”为“get”(标题前空两格,标题后空一格连续编辑)3.设置“动作”为“end.asp”(此处为表单处理程序的文件名及路径)二、根据静态页面来制作动态页面end.asp(一)理解读写文本文件的方法及原理1.FileSystemObject对象(1)在ASP程序中,想要存取文件,必须先建立FileSystemObject对象(2)利用这个对象调用OpenTextFile(打开文件)或CreateTextFile(创建文件)建立File对象(3)最后才调用File对象的WriteLine及ReadLine存取文件(4)语法:16 setFileSystemObject名=server.createobject(“scripting.filesystemobject”)例:setfso=server.createobject(“scripting.filesystemobject”)2.setfile对象名=filesystemobject名.opentextfile(文件完整的路径,IO模式,是否自动创建文件)setfile对象名=filesystemobject名.createtextfile(文件完整的路径,是否覆盖原文件)参数含义:文件完整的路径:欲取得文件的完整路径,应调用服务器对象的mappath方法,例如想取得目前目录”gbbook.txt”的完整路径,使用的方法是“filepath=server.mappath(“gbbook.txt”)”IO模式:可设置成ForReading(=1)或ForAppending(=8),若设置成ForReading,则打开文件是只读的,若设置成Appending,则打开的文件是追加的,不能读。可省略,若省,表示ForReading。是否自动创建文件:可设置成True或False,设置成True,则当文件不存在时,会自动建立一个新文件,若设置成False,当文件不存在时,会产生错误。可省略,若省略,表示False。(二)编辑表单处理程序end.asp1.得到静态表单传来的数据,ball=request("ball")2.把传来的数据转为数值型,count=cint(ball)3.得到选票记录的文本文件test.txt的完整物理路径,fo=server.mappath("test.txt")1.得到操作的文件对象,并设置成文件属性为可读,setfs=server.createobject("scripting.filesystemobject")setfn=fs.opentextfile(fo,1)2.循环读出文本文件中的记录数fori=lbound(sum)toubound(sum)sum(i)=fn.readline6.把记录数读到application变量中,application(sum(i))=sum(i)7.判断用户选择的球类并记录下来,ifcount=ithenapplication.lockapplication(sum(i))=application(sum(i))+1application.unlock8.得到记录总数,all=all+application(sum(i))9.得到选票的百分比fori=lbound(sum)toubound(sum)per(i)=application(sum(i))/all*100next10.给出反馈页面足球:<%=application(sum(0))%>人百分比:<%=csng(per(0))%>%
篮球:<%=application(sum(1))%>人百分比:<%=csng(per(1))%>%
16 排球:<%=application(sum(2))%>人百分比:<%=csng(per(2))%>%
11.把得到的记录数记录再写到文本文件中setfn=fs.createtextfile(fo,true)fori=lbound(sum)toubound(sum)fn.writelineapplication(sum(i))next12.防止重复投票ifisempty(session("conneted"))then。。。。session("conneted")=true三、在相同文件夹下建立文本文件test.txt创建文本文件test.txt(一)输入原始文本“0”16 (一)保存该文本文件test.txt16 实验(训)二筛选排序例一、利用Access创建数据库及建表(一)打开Access数据库(二)创建数据库并保存1.单击“文件”选择“新建”16 2.保存数据库(三)创建、设计数据表并添加数据1.创建表16 1.设计表3.添加数据表数据并保存16 二、利用DreamWeaver创建筛选的静态页面(一)插入表单容器并设置提示文本,表单样式1.单击“插入面板”中的“表单”标签如上图2.插入3*2的“0”边框表格(1)单击“插入面板”中的“常用”标签(2)单击“表格”标签(3)按下图进行设置16 3.合并最后一行的两个单元格,如下图(二)插入提示文本和表单元素(单行文本输入框)并设置其属性插入提示文本,如下图所示2.插入表单元素(1)单击“插入面板”中的“表单”标签(2)在对应表格单元格插入表单元素16 3.设置表单元素属性(1)单击“插入面板”中的“表单”标签(2)在对应表格单元格插入表单元素(三)设置表单属性1.点击“”标签2.设置“动作”为“shaipai.asp”16 三、理解WEB数据库的工作原理并驱动连接、给出筛选排序主要代码(一)WEB数据库的工作原理及使用的方法1.建立一个Connection对象:connSetconn=server.createobject(“ADODB.Connection”)2.调用conn.open方法如打开Advworks.mdb数据库Conn.open”drive={MicrosoftAccessDrive(*.mdb)};dbq=”&Server.mappath(“Advworks.mdb”)参数中含有“drive={Microsoft….”的内容,表示我们要透过Access的ODBC驱动程序来存取数据库,dbq参数则用来指定欲打开的数据库文件,它必须是完整的路径名称。3.调用conn.execute函数建立recordset对象:rs,如Setrs=conn.execute(“customers”)(二)编写输出记录集方法过程<%'将Recordset输出成HTML的“表格”SubRsToTable(rs)'PartI:输出数据库的“表头”Response.Write"
"Response.Write""Fori=0tors.Fields.Count-1Response.WRITE""&rs.Fields(i).Name&""NextResponse.Write""'PartII:输出数据库的“内容”WhileNotrs.EOFResponse.Write""Fori=0tors.Fields.Count-1Response.WRITE""&rs.Fields(i).Value&""NextResponse.Write""rs.MoveNextWend16 Response.Write"
"EndSub%>(三)编辑表单处理程序shaipai.asp1.得到静态表单传来的数据,criteria=request("criteria"),sort=request(“sort”)2.默认的sql值,sql=”select*from成绩单”3.得到筛选和排序条件ifcriteria<>””thensql=sql&”where”&criteriaendififsort<>””thensql=sql&”orderby”&sortendif1.得到记录集setrs=conn.Excute(sql)2.输出筛选和排序的记录集RsToTablers16

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。
关闭